The database criteria for the diagnosis of IBD, UC, CD and IBDU

IBD
All patients had to have at least one hospitalization, or four physician claims, within a two year period for a diagnosis of IBD.
  • IBD patients were then classified as UC, CD or IBDU as follows.
  • Each medical contact for the Physician Billing claims database was scored as + 1 (UC) or -1 (CD).
  • Each medical contact for the Discharge Abstract database was scored as +2 (UC) or -2 (CD).
  • A cumulative score was calculated for each patient.
UC
Patients with a cumulative score greater than +2.
CD
Patients with a cumulative score less than -2.
IBDU Patients with a cumulative score equal to, or between, -2 and +2.
